- Medical Genetics Physician Opportunity- Baystate Health
Description
Baystate Health is a not-for-profit, integrated healthcare system in western Massachusetts which consists of an academic medical center, Baystate Children's Hospital, three community hospitals and the region's largest multispecialty group. Our flagship hospital, Baystate Medical Center, is home to the University of Massachusetts Chan Medical School-Baystate.
POSITION HIGHLIGHTS:
• Housed in the Dept. of Pediatrics, our Genetics program provides care for patients across the lifespan. The program includes pediatric genetics, reproductive genetics and genetic counseling, cancer genetics and genetic counseling (Family Cancer Risk program), adult genetics, and our nationally recognized lysosomal storage disorders program.
• Join our Chief of Genetics, five genetic counselors, a care coordinator and an MA who practice in our outpatient pediatric specialty center in Springfield, MA. We also provide an inpatient consult service.
• Faculty appointment at UMass Chan Medical School- Baystate. Our clinical educators foster an environment of educational excellence through direction of our resident elective and lecturing to residents and med students.
• Qualifications: BE/BC Medical Genetics. Excellent mentorship available.
• Our compensation package consists of a base salary of between $200,000- $220,000 (based on 1.0 FTE, experience level and qualifications) and annual incentive bonus opportunities.
